Rolf Reininghaus, President of Crystaal, commented "due to the growing awareness and recognitionof ADHD in children by the public and the medical community, coupled with the growth of diagnoses in adults, the market for therapies aimed at this condition is expected to grow in Canada to U.S.$50 to $100 million by the year 2000 and beyond. Crystaal plans to become the market leader in this segment with the introduction of d-MPH." Concurrent with the licensing agreement, Biovail has entered into a Stock Purchase Agreement whereby Biovail will purchase U.S. $2.5 million of newly issued Celgene Corporation stock. Biovail Corporation International is an international full-service pharmaceutical company, engaged in the formulation, clinical testing, registration and manufacture of drug products utilizing advanced drug delivery technologies.
